如何调试美食滤镜功能呢
作者:福州美食网
|
267人看过
发布时间:2026-05-25 15:47:33
标签:如何调试美食滤镜功能呢
如何调试美食滤镜功能:深度实用指南在现代网页设计中,美食滤镜功能已成为提升用户体验的重要元素。它不仅能够增强视觉吸引力,还能通过视觉效果引导用户注意力,提升浏览效率。然而,许多开发者在实现美食滤镜功能时,往往遇到性能问题、视觉效果不一
如何调试美食滤镜功能:深度实用指南
在现代网页设计中,美食滤镜功能已成为提升用户体验的重要元素。它不仅能够增强视觉吸引力,还能通过视觉效果引导用户注意力,提升浏览效率。然而,许多开发者在实现美食滤镜功能时,往往遇到性能问题、视觉效果不一致、用户体验不佳等问题。因此,深入理解如何调试美食滤镜功能,对于提升网站质量和用户满意度至关重要。
一、理解美食滤镜功能的核心原理
美食滤镜功能的核心在于通过CSS和JavaScript实现图像的视觉效果。常见的滤镜包括模糊、对比度调整、颜色增强、阴影效果等。这些效果通常通过CSS的`filter`属性实现,例如:
css
.filter
filter: grayscale(0.5) blur(1px);
此外,JavaScript可以通过监听用户交互事件(如点击、滑动)来动态调整滤镜效果,实现更丰富的交互体验。
二、性能优化:确保滤镜加载流畅
在调试美食滤镜功能时,性能问题往往是首要关注的。滤镜效果可能会对页面加载速度产生影响,尤其是在大量图片同时应用滤镜时。
优化策略:
1. 预加载滤镜资源:在图片加载前预加载滤镜效果,避免因滤镜加载延迟而影响用户体验。
2. 使用Web Workers:对于复杂的滤镜计算,可以使用Web Workers执行,避免阻塞主线程,提升性能。
3. 缓存滤镜效果:对频繁使用的滤镜效果进行缓存,减少重复计算和资源消耗。
三、视觉效果调试:确保一致性与美观性
视觉效果的调试是确保美食滤镜功能吸引用户的关键。滤镜效果必须与整体页面风格保持一致,同时在不同设备上保持良好显示。
调试方法:
1. 使用浏览器开发者工具:通过Chrome开发者工具,可以实时查看滤镜效果的渲染情况,调整参数以获得最佳视觉效果。
2. 测试不同设备和屏幕尺寸:确保滤镜在不同分辨率和屏幕比例下显示正常,不出现失真或布局错乱。
3. 调整滤镜参数:根据实际需求调整模糊度、对比度、饱和度等参数,确保效果既不过于强烈,又不失视觉冲击力。
四、用户体验优化:提升操作便捷性
美食滤镜功能的使用应以用户为中心,提升操作便捷性,避免用户因操作复杂而放弃使用。
优化策略:
1. 提供清晰的使用指引:在页面上明确显示如何应用滤镜,例如通过按钮或滑块。
2. 支持多种滤镜选择:提供多种滤镜选项,让用户可以根据个人喜好选择不同的视觉效果。
3. 避免过度使用滤镜:过度使用滤镜可能导致视觉疲劳,应合理控制滤镜的使用频率和强度。
五、兼容性测试:确保功能在不同平台和浏览器中正常运行
美食滤镜功能需要在多个平台和浏览器中正常运行,因此兼容性测试至关重要。
测试方法:
1. 测试主流浏览器:包括Chrome、Firefox、Safari、Edge等,确保滤镜效果在不同浏览器中一致。
2. 测试不同操作系统:确保滤镜在Windows、Mac、Linux等系统中正常运行。
3. 测试移动端:确保滤镜在移动端浏览器中显示良好,不出现布局错乱或性能问题。
六、数据反馈与用户行为分析
调试美食滤镜功能不仅需要技术层面的优化,还需要通过用户行为数据分析来不断改进功能。
数据分析策略:
1. 收集用户反馈:通过问卷调查或用户评论,了解用户对滤镜效果的满意度。
2. 分析用户行为:观察用户点击滤镜按钮的频率、使用时间等数据,优化交互设计。
3. 进行A/B测试:通过对比不同滤镜效果的使用情况,找出最佳方案。
七、高级调试技巧:深入分析问题根源
对于复杂的问题,需要深入分析其根源,才能有效解决。
调试技巧:
1. 使用性能分析工具:如Chrome DevTools的Performance面板,分析滤镜加载和渲染的性能瓶颈。
2. 日志记录与调试:在代码中添加日志记录,跟踪滤镜效果的加载和应用过程。
3. 使用调试器:通过浏览器调试器逐步检查滤镜效果的执行流程,定位问题所在。
八、常见问题与解决方案
在调试美食滤镜功能时,可能会遇到一些常见问题,以下是常见问题及解决方案:
1. 滤镜效果不一致:检查滤镜参数是否统一,确保所有图片应用相同的滤镜。
2. 滤镜加载延迟:优化滤镜资源加载,使用预加载技术,减少加载时间。
3. 滤镜在移动端显示异常:调整滤镜参数,确保在移动端显示正常,不出现失真。
4. 滤镜影响页面布局:调整滤镜参数,确保滤镜不会影响页面布局,保持整体美观。
九、未来发展方向:智能化滤镜与个性化体验
随着技术的发展,美食滤镜功能将向智能化和个性化方向发展。
发展方向:
1. AI驱动的滤镜推荐:根据用户喜好和浏览习惯,推荐合适的滤镜效果。
2. 动态滤镜调整:根据用户的操作行为,动态调整滤镜参数,提供更个性化的体验。
3. 多语言支持:确保滤镜效果在不同语言环境下显示正常,提升用户体验。
十、总结:调试美食滤镜功能的关键在于细节与体验
调试美食滤镜功能是一个系统化、细致的过程,需要从性能、视觉效果、用户体验等多个方面进行优化。通过合理的性能优化、细致的视觉调试、良好的用户体验设计,才能确保美食滤镜功能在实际应用中达到最佳效果。
在实际开发过程中,建议开发者持续关注用户反馈,不断优化滤镜功能,提升网站的整体质量和用户体验。同时,也要不断学习新技术,探索更先进的滤镜效果,为用户带来更加丰富的视觉体验。
在现代网页设计中,美食滤镜功能已成为提升用户体验的重要元素。它不仅能够增强视觉吸引力,还能通过视觉效果引导用户注意力,提升浏览效率。然而,许多开发者在实现美食滤镜功能时,往往遇到性能问题、视觉效果不一致、用户体验不佳等问题。因此,深入理解如何调试美食滤镜功能,对于提升网站质量和用户满意度至关重要。
一、理解美食滤镜功能的核心原理
美食滤镜功能的核心在于通过CSS和JavaScript实现图像的视觉效果。常见的滤镜包括模糊、对比度调整、颜色增强、阴影效果等。这些效果通常通过CSS的`filter`属性实现,例如:
css
.filter
filter: grayscale(0.5) blur(1px);
此外,JavaScript可以通过监听用户交互事件(如点击、滑动)来动态调整滤镜效果,实现更丰富的交互体验。
二、性能优化:确保滤镜加载流畅
在调试美食滤镜功能时,性能问题往往是首要关注的。滤镜效果可能会对页面加载速度产生影响,尤其是在大量图片同时应用滤镜时。
优化策略:
1. 预加载滤镜资源:在图片加载前预加载滤镜效果,避免因滤镜加载延迟而影响用户体验。
2. 使用Web Workers:对于复杂的滤镜计算,可以使用Web Workers执行,避免阻塞主线程,提升性能。
3. 缓存滤镜效果:对频繁使用的滤镜效果进行缓存,减少重复计算和资源消耗。
三、视觉效果调试:确保一致性与美观性
视觉效果的调试是确保美食滤镜功能吸引用户的关键。滤镜效果必须与整体页面风格保持一致,同时在不同设备上保持良好显示。
调试方法:
1. 使用浏览器开发者工具:通过Chrome开发者工具,可以实时查看滤镜效果的渲染情况,调整参数以获得最佳视觉效果。
2. 测试不同设备和屏幕尺寸:确保滤镜在不同分辨率和屏幕比例下显示正常,不出现失真或布局错乱。
3. 调整滤镜参数:根据实际需求调整模糊度、对比度、饱和度等参数,确保效果既不过于强烈,又不失视觉冲击力。
四、用户体验优化:提升操作便捷性
美食滤镜功能的使用应以用户为中心,提升操作便捷性,避免用户因操作复杂而放弃使用。
优化策略:
1. 提供清晰的使用指引:在页面上明确显示如何应用滤镜,例如通过按钮或滑块。
2. 支持多种滤镜选择:提供多种滤镜选项,让用户可以根据个人喜好选择不同的视觉效果。
3. 避免过度使用滤镜:过度使用滤镜可能导致视觉疲劳,应合理控制滤镜的使用频率和强度。
五、兼容性测试:确保功能在不同平台和浏览器中正常运行
美食滤镜功能需要在多个平台和浏览器中正常运行,因此兼容性测试至关重要。
测试方法:
1. 测试主流浏览器:包括Chrome、Firefox、Safari、Edge等,确保滤镜效果在不同浏览器中一致。
2. 测试不同操作系统:确保滤镜在Windows、Mac、Linux等系统中正常运行。
3. 测试移动端:确保滤镜在移动端浏览器中显示良好,不出现布局错乱或性能问题。
六、数据反馈与用户行为分析
调试美食滤镜功能不仅需要技术层面的优化,还需要通过用户行为数据分析来不断改进功能。
数据分析策略:
1. 收集用户反馈:通过问卷调查或用户评论,了解用户对滤镜效果的满意度。
2. 分析用户行为:观察用户点击滤镜按钮的频率、使用时间等数据,优化交互设计。
3. 进行A/B测试:通过对比不同滤镜效果的使用情况,找出最佳方案。
七、高级调试技巧:深入分析问题根源
对于复杂的问题,需要深入分析其根源,才能有效解决。
调试技巧:
1. 使用性能分析工具:如Chrome DevTools的Performance面板,分析滤镜加载和渲染的性能瓶颈。
2. 日志记录与调试:在代码中添加日志记录,跟踪滤镜效果的加载和应用过程。
3. 使用调试器:通过浏览器调试器逐步检查滤镜效果的执行流程,定位问题所在。
八、常见问题与解决方案
在调试美食滤镜功能时,可能会遇到一些常见问题,以下是常见问题及解决方案:
1. 滤镜效果不一致:检查滤镜参数是否统一,确保所有图片应用相同的滤镜。
2. 滤镜加载延迟:优化滤镜资源加载,使用预加载技术,减少加载时间。
3. 滤镜在移动端显示异常:调整滤镜参数,确保在移动端显示正常,不出现失真。
4. 滤镜影响页面布局:调整滤镜参数,确保滤镜不会影响页面布局,保持整体美观。
九、未来发展方向:智能化滤镜与个性化体验
随着技术的发展,美食滤镜功能将向智能化和个性化方向发展。
发展方向:
1. AI驱动的滤镜推荐:根据用户喜好和浏览习惯,推荐合适的滤镜效果。
2. 动态滤镜调整:根据用户的操作行为,动态调整滤镜参数,提供更个性化的体验。
3. 多语言支持:确保滤镜效果在不同语言环境下显示正常,提升用户体验。
十、总结:调试美食滤镜功能的关键在于细节与体验
调试美食滤镜功能是一个系统化、细致的过程,需要从性能、视觉效果、用户体验等多个方面进行优化。通过合理的性能优化、细致的视觉调试、良好的用户体验设计,才能确保美食滤镜功能在实际应用中达到最佳效果。
在实际开发过程中,建议开发者持续关注用户反馈,不断优化滤镜功能,提升网站的整体质量和用户体验。同时,也要不断学习新技术,探索更先进的滤镜效果,为用户带来更加丰富的视觉体验。
推荐文章
枣米美食口感如何?从营养到风味的深度解析枣米作为一种传统的中式食材,自古以来便备受推崇。在众多食材中,枣米以其独特的风味和丰富的营养价值,成为餐桌上的常客。尤其在北方地区,枣米常用于制作甜点、粥品,而在南方,则多用于烹饪中增添风味。本
2026-05-25 15:47:11
330人看过
如何撰写一篇深度实用的探店美食文案:从结构到内容的全面解析探店美食文案是吸引读者、提升品牌影响力的重要工具。一篇好的探店文案不仅要呈现美食本身,更要传达出用餐的体验、氛围、文化内涵,甚至是对美食背后故事的解读。本文将从文案的结构、内容
2026-05-25 15:46:46
270人看过
如何把美食拼成很多照片:深度实用指南在快节奏的生活中,美食不仅是一种享受,更是一种文化、一种记忆。而将美食与照片结合,不仅能够记录下美味的瞬间,更能将视觉与味觉的体验融合,带来独特的艺术感。本文将从多个角度探讨如何将美食拼成很多照片,
2026-05-25 14:09:08
308人看过
美食如何配音和画面同步:从感官体验到视觉节奏的完美融合美食,作为人类文明中最原始、最直观的感官体验之一,其魅力不仅在于味道、香气和口感,更在于其与视觉、听觉、触觉的全方位互动。在现代餐饮行业中,美食的“配音”与“画面同步”不仅是视觉上
2026-05-25 14:08:41
205人看过



